Short Description
A professional 1000g (1kg) machinist hammer featuring a forged CS45 steel head and a UV-resistant ash wood handle for heavy-duty striking.
Country of origin: Poland
Specifications
- Brand: Hogert Technik
- Weight (Approx.) : 1.1 kg
- Net Quantity : 1 pc
- Model Number: HT3B010
- Product Type: Machinist Hammer / Fitter Hammer
- Head Weight: 1000 g (1 kg)
- Total Length: 360 mm
- Head Material: Forged CS45 Carbon Steel
- Hardness Rating: 52–58 HRC
- Handle Material: Premium Ash Wood (Varnished)
- Manufacturing Standards: DIN 1193
- Safety Certification: TÜV Rheinland Germany
Description
The Högert Technik HT3B010 Machinist Hammer 1000g (1 kg) is a heavy-duty striking tool engineered for demanding construction, structural engineering, metal fabrication, workshop maintenance, and industrial repair applications. Crafted from premium forged CS45 carbon steel, the hammer head undergoes induction hardening to achieve a rating of 52–58 HRC, delivering exceptional impact energy, superior wear resistance, and long service life. Equipped with a high-grade ash wood handle that undergoes a specialized drying process, the tool offers excellent shock absorption while minimizing the risk of handle warping or cracking. The ergonomic handle features a protective varnish coating that shields against UV radiation and ambient moisture, ensuring maximum grip comfort and longevity in harsh workshop conditions. For complete operational safety, the hammer head is permanently locked to the wooden shaft using a heavy-duty metal wedge system. Certified by TÜV Rheinland Germany and manufactured according to DIN 1193 standards, this 1kg machinist hammer is an indispensable tool for professional mechanics, fabricators, and engineers.

Usage
:- Pre-Strike Safety Inspection: Examine the steel head, wooden handle, and metal wedge to ensure the assembly is intact and tight before use.
- Proper Leverage Grip: Hold the ergonomic handle near the bottom end to maximize kinetic energy and leverage during high-impact striking.
- Centered Impact: Strike target objects squarely on the flat or peen striking face to ensure maximum energy transfer and prevent tool slippage.
- Safety Gear: Always wear protective safety goggles and work gloves when executing high-impact steel-on-steel striking.
- Storage & Care: Clean off oil or grease with a dry rag after use and store in a dry, ventilated workspace to protect the ash wood seal.
